Virtual reality and ear zaps tested to soothe pain and anxiety

NCT ID NCT07198737

Summary

This study is testing whether combining two relaxing technologies can help people with long-term shoulder pain. Participants will use a virtual reality headset for calming scenes while a small device sends gentle electrical pulses to their outer ear. The goal is to see if this combo is practical and safe, and if it might ease pain, anxiety, and depression while people wait for shoulder surgery.
